How to Identify a Trusted Conservatory Contractor
Determining a trustworthy and skilled contractor involves research study and due diligence. Here are some actions house owners can require to evaluate potential professionals:
1. Conduct Thorough Research
Local Referrals: Ask pals, family, or neighbors who have actually recently developed a conservatory for recommendations.

Online Reviews: Platforms such as Google, Yelp, and social media can offer insights regarding specialists' reputations. Search for consistent, favorable feedback.

[Professional Conservatory Refurbishment Services](http://114.67.155.184:3000/affordable-conservatory-installation4674) Bodies: Check if the contractor is a member of certified professional associations like the Federation of Master Builders (FMB) or the Glass and Glazing Federation (GGF).
2. Examine Experience and Qualifications
Specialization in Conservatories: Contractors need to have a tested performance history specifically in constructing conservatories.

Accreditations: Verify that the contractor possesses valid certifications, as this typically reflects their commitment to quality and continuous training.
3. Request Detailed Quotes and References
Relative Quotes: Obtain multiple quotes from different contractors. A comprehensive breakdown of expenses can help determine what is sensible.

Previous Work References: Ask for referrals of previous projects. A reputable contractor should willingly supply examples of their previous work in addition to reviews from previous customers.
4. Evaluate Communication Skills
Preliminary Meeting: Pay attention to how the contractor interacts throughout your preliminary meeting. Are they responsive to your concepts? Do they respond to concerns transparently? Excellent interaction is a vital part of a successful task.

Handling of Concerns: Gauge how the contractor deals with any issues you raise. A credible contractor will be proactive and solution-oriented.
5. Verify Insurance and Warranty
Public Liability Insurance: Ensure the contractor has appropriate insurance protection to protect versus accidents and liabilities throughout the construction process.

Work Warranty: Confirm that there will be a guarantee for the construction work, covering prospective defects or repairs required after completion.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: What is the typical expense of developing a conservatory?
The average cost for a conservatory can differ substantially, usually ranging anywhere from ₤ 15,000 to ₤ 50,000 or more, depending upon size, products, and design complexity.
Q2: How long does it require to build a conservatory?
The construction of a conservatory usually takes in between 6 to 12 weeks. Aspects affecting the timeline include the design complexity, weather conditions, and local council approvals.
Q3: Do I need preparing permission for a conservatory?
Whether planning approval is needed can depend upon factors such as size, area, and specific local guidelines. It is a good idea to talk to the contractor or local council about requirements.
Q4: What design styles can I select from?
Modern conservatories come in different designs, including Edwardian, Victorian, lean-to, and gable-fronted, amongst others. A trusted contractor can assist in choosing the most ideal design for your home.
Q5: Can a conservatory be used year-round?
With proper insulation, heating and cooling systems, modern conservatories can be utilized throughout the year, enhancing the functionality and comfort of the space.
